1. SAFETY PRECAUTION
The AC Drive is a power electronic device.For safety reasons,please read carefully those paragraphs with "WARNING" or
"CAUTION" symbols.They are important safety precautions to be aware of while transporting,installing,operating,or examining
the AC drive. Please follow these precautions to ensure your safety.
WARNING Personal injury may result from improper operation.
CAUTION The AC Drive or mechanical system may be damaged by improper operation.
WARNING
❙ Do not touch the PCB or components on the PCB right after turning off power and before the charging indicator goes off.
❙ Do not attempt to wire circuits while power is on.Do not attempt to examine the components and signals on the PCB
while the AC drive is operating.
❙ Do not attempt to disassemble or modify internal circuitry, wiring,or components of the AC drive.
❙ The grounding terminal of the AC drive must be grounded properly with 200V class type III standard.
❙ This is a product of the restricted sales distribution class according to EN61800-3.
❙ This product may cause radio interference.The user may be required to take adequate measures for RFI protection.
CAUTION
❙ Do not attempt to perform dielectric strength tests on internal components of the AC Drive.There are sensitive
semiconductor-devices vulnerable to high voltages.
❙ Do not connect the output terminals:T1 (U),T2 (V), and T3 (W) to AC power input.
❙ The CMOS IC on the primary PCB of the AC drive is vulnerable to static electrical charges. Do not touch the primary PCB
of the AC drive.
